Black and White by Goodnightmoon

Link: Black and White
Summary: Everything was black and white for Angie Calivari." A student teacher, who came back to the small town he once hated falls in love with a girl he knows he can't have.

My review: It has potential. This short story (though it may be too short to call it that). Perhaps I'll call it a 'glimpse' is about a student teacher who is infatuated with one of his students. The reader is shown his thoughts about this girl named Angie who is dorky looking. Although she's not gorgeous per se, he likes her.

I liked the direction this story was going in, but it ended too soon to be memorable. The author could have continued with this teacher's tale, let us watch him and Angie bond rather than summing up their relationship by saying 'they grew up together.' That's nice, but I want to watch them interact and discover for myself why this guy likes this chick so much. This tale fell flat because there was no depth. We were asked to just assume that Angie, this girl who doesn't seem at all interesting, just happened to capture this man's heart. I understand that this was supposed to be a short story, but there's no story. Not really. The author could have done more with this story.

Aside from the plot, or lack there of, the tense shifts within the story were distracting. Some parts were in past while other parts were in present tense. The description used was good though. The author did a great job describing the main character's surroundings. She/he is really good with the tiny details when it comes to setting.

I'd give this story a 3/5 points.
